Cadel Evans to return home for Tour de France celebrations

6:44 pm on 3 August 2011

The Tour de France winner Cadel Evans will return home to Australia for the first time since historic win in Paris last month.

The 34-year-old, who became the first Australian to win road cycling's biggest prize last month, will be paraded through the centre of Melbourne on Friday week.

Evans wasn't scheduled to return to Australia until the end of the year but says he's looking forward to picking up the celebrations after his triumph in Paris.
